Standard deviation as a risk measure
A statistical measure of the dispersion of returns around the expected value, expressed in the same units as the return itself - which is why the square root of variance is taken.

- BetaHow sharply a share moves relative to the market index — beta 1 moves with the index, above 1 amplifies it, below 1 dampens it. The standard measure of systematic risk.
- Modern Portfolio TheoryMarkowitz's framework for building portfolios on expected return and risk together, in which the co-movement between holdings — not their individual riskiness — decides the risk of the whole.
